Punteggio 94/100 · Da bere 2022-2030, Eric Guido, Vinous, Jun 2021

You could lose yourself in the seductive bouquet of the 2016 Etna Rosso N'Anticchia. Sweet exotic spices yield to crushed cherries, strawberries, candied citrus and white smoke. This is elegant and silky on the palate yet also lifted in feel, with ripe red and hints of blue fruit coasting along a wave of vibrant acidity. Its minerality comes forward toward the close, mixing with notes of grilled orange and red licorice that linger incredibly long. All of this, combined with sweet tannins that provide classic grip without ever getting in the way, creates a highly pleasurable experience. The N'Anticchia spends 18 months in barriques (50% new and 50% second pass), which is perfectly integrated here.

Punteggio 17/20 · Da bere 2021-2028, Walter Speller, jancisrobinson.com, Mar 2021

Nerello Mascalese from a vineyard of bush vines planted at a density of 8,000 vines/ha. Fermented in stainless steel, then undergoes MLF in barriques. Aged for 18 months in first- and second-passage barriques. Lustrous mid ruby with brickstone rim. Sweetly perfumed raspberry and oak nose which with aeration becomes more lifted, aromatic and oak-driven. Juicy raspberry and oak on the palate with crunchy tannins. Modernist. No doubt will appeal to many. (WS)
